WebPebbles Flintstone was born at the Rockville Hospital on February 22nd, 10,000 B. C. at 8:20 P M. She weighed 6 pounds, 12 ounces, equaling 108 ounces. Her name originated from Wilma's maiden name of Pebble. At the time of her birth Fred that she was "a pebble off the old Flintstone", thus her parents picked her name. WebJan 21, 2024 · The short answer is no. Flintstones are not a replacement for prenatal vitamins. Prenatal vitamins contain higher levels of certain nutrients like folic acid and iron, which are important for pregnant women. Flintstones also do not contain omega-3 fatty acids, another important nutrient for pregnant women.
